Table 5 Allergen molecules of fungal origin1 used in singleplex and multiplex immunoassays[9,74,106-108]
Allergen moleculeBiological function, comments, CR
Ascomycetes fungi (Alternaria alternata, Cladosporium herbarum, Aspergillus fumigatus)
rAlt a 1Fungal beta-barrel protein, detected in spores before germination
Involvement in Alternaria-spinach syndrome
rAlt a 6Fungal enolase, panallergen CR Cla h 6, Asp f 22, Pen c 22
rCla h 8Fungal mannitol dehydrogenase, major allergen, CR Alt a 8
rAsp f 1Fungal ribotoxin, specific major allergen, member of the mitogillin family
Not present in spores, but produced after germination and growth
Genuine exposure and IgE sensitization to A. fumigatus germinated in the respiratory tract
rAsp f 2Species-specific allergen component, with high frequency of sensitization among patients affected by ABPA
rAsp f 3 rAsp f 4Fungal peroxisomal protein, CR Pen c 3
Fungal protein, highly specific allergen
With high frequency of sensitization among ABPA patients
rAsp f 6Fungal Mn-SOD, CR Alt a 14, Mala s 11
